What is bacteriostatic water?
Bacteriostatic water is sterile water that contains 0.9% benzyl alcohol as a preservative. The benzyl alcohol inhibits the growth of bacteria, which allows the vial to be accessed multiple times while maintaining the sterility of the solution. It is one of the most commonly used solutions in research and laboratory environments.
What is the difference between bacteriostatic water and sterile water?
The key difference is the preservative. Sterile water contains no additives and is intended for single use — once accessed, it should be discarded. Bacteriostatic water contains 0.9% benzyl alcohol, which prevents bacterial growth and allows the vial to be used multiple times over a 28-day period.
What is phosphate buffered saline (PBS)?
Phosphate buffered saline is an isotonic buffer solution that maintains a stable pH of 7.4. It contains a balanced mix of sodium chloride and phosphate salts. PBS is widely used in research for sample dilution, reagent preparation, and equipment rinsing.

How should I store bacteriostatic water?
Store at controlled room temperature between 20°C and 25°C (68°F – 77°F). Keep away from direct sunlight and do not freeze. Once a vial has been accessed, use the remaining contents within 28 days using proper aseptic technique.
